Sponsor Spotlight: Ferozas Jewelery

To say that Husneara loves to get creative with her handcrafted jewelry would be an understatement. As the force behind Etsy boutique Ferozas Jewelery, Husneara brings her passion to life in the form of exclusive, one-of-a-kind earrings, necklaces, bracelets and wedding jewelry. She sees her work as a way of expressing herself, and here’s what she had to say about what jewelry making has meant to her over the years! xoxo

I am a grandmother of four and mother of three kids with a passion for creativity. All my life, I have enjoyed expressing my creativity in various forms, whether writing poetry, creating batik, making cloth dolls, sugar crafting to make cakes or simply making a meal for my family. I enjoy the process of making something beautiful. My latest passion is making handcrafted jewelry, which I have been doing for three years.

Even though my educational background is in literature, I have been producing various types of crafts all my life as a hobby. For the jewelry I am making now, I took a couple of courses to learn new techniques. The Internet has also been a great source of information to learn from as well.

I design jewelry from my heart and only make the pieces when I am enjoying the work. Mostly, I use gemstones, pearl, gold filled, and sterling silver. I collect my materials from different sources, and let the materials inspire me when I am designing the jewelry.
